Description

A kind of composite plate cutter device
Technical field
The present invention relates to a kind of composite plate cutter device.
Background technology
, it is necessary to be cut according to the demand of client to it in the production of composite plate, traditional cutting typically uses people Work mode is cut, and is wasted time and energy, and cutting accuracy is poor, carries inconvenience.Prior art also has some composite plate cutter devices, but one As it is all simple in construction, cutting effect is poor, low production efficiency.
The content of the invention
The technical problem to be solved in the present invention is:Overcome the deficiencies in the prior art, there is provided a kind of composite plate cutter device, it is real Cutting efficiency is now improved, ensures cutting accuracy.
The technical solution adopted for the present invention to solve the technical problems is:A kind of composite plate cutter device, its structure include Conveyer belt, side pressing mechanism, extrude press mechanism, laser cutting mechanism, cross roll road and hopper, wherein conveyer belt are arranged on main support On, it is baffled at left and right sides of conveyer belt, ceiling hold is set above conveyer belt, transverse shifting rail, transverse shifting rail are set in the middle part of ceiling hold On set transverse slide, transverse slide bottom connection hydraulic telescopic device, hydraulic telescopic device bottom connection plate, Connection is cut by laser mechanism on installing plate bottom surface, and setting one respectively on the ceiling hold bottom surface of transverse shifting rail front and rear sides extrudes pressure Mechanism, it is cut by laser and is respectively provided with a breach corresponding to below mechanism on the baffle plate of the left and right sides of conveyer belt, outside two breach Side respectively sets one and extrudes press mechanism, and the rear end of conveyer belt sets cross roll road, and the rear end in cross roll road sets hopper, and cross roll road is close to conveyer belt One end be higher than close to hopper one end.
Preferably, described laser cutting mechanism includes generating device of laser, laser delivery pipe and laser cutting head, wherein Generating device of laser is arranged on installing plate bottom surface, generating device of laser bottom connection laser delivery pipe, laser conveying bottom of the tube Laser cutting head is connected, laser delivery pipe side sets auxiliary gas inlet.
Preferably, described side pressing mechanism includes side cylinder, and side cylinder connects side guide, the first rubber is set on side guide Pad.
Preferably, the described press mechanism that extrudes includes top gas cylinder, and top gas cylinder connects top pressing board, the second rubber is set on top pressing board Pad, extruding for front and rear sides set wood properly test device and thickness detection apparatus respectively on the second rubber blanket of press mechanism.
Preferably, described cross roll road sets infrared sensor above one end of hopper.
Preferably, touch screen and scram button are set on described main support side.
The beneficial effects of the invention are as follows:It is simple in construction effectively, the composite plate that two side shields can prevent drop and carry out it is spacing, two Side side pressing mechanism and extrude press mechanism and can carry out compression positioning to composite plate, extrude the wood properly test device and thickness of press mechanism Detection means can detect to composite plate material and thickness, laser cutting mechanism is suitably adjusted, hydraulic telescopic device The required height of adjustable laser cutting mechanism, laser cutting mechanism can be slid laterally by transverse slide is cut, The composite plate for cutting completion can be transported in hopper by cross roll road, composite plate can be counted by infrared sensor, be improved Production efficiency, ensure that cutting accuracy, ensure that product quality.

Embodiment
Presently in connection with accompanying drawing, the present invention is further illustrated.These accompanying drawings are simplified schematic diagram only with signal side Formula illustrates the basic structure of the present invention, therefore it only shows the composition relevant with the present invention.
As shown in figure 1, a kind of composite plate cutter device, its structure include conveyer belt 2, side pressing mechanism, extrude press mechanism, Mechanism, cross roll road 6 and hopper 7 are cut by laser, wherein conveyer belt 2 is arranged on main support 1, and the left and right sides of conveyer belt 2 is baffled 3, the top of conveyer belt 2 sets ceiling hold 4, and the middle part of ceiling hold 4 sets transverse shifting rail 5, transverse slide is set on transverse shifting rail 5 19, the bottom of transverse slide 19 connection hydraulic telescopic device 20, the bottom connection plate 21 of hydraulic telescopic device 20, installing plate Connection is cut by laser mechanism on 21 bottom surfaces, and setting one respectively on the bottom surface of ceiling hold 4 of the front and rear sides of transverse shifting rail 5 extrudes press Structure, a breach 8, two breach 8 are respectively provided with the baffle plate 3 of the left and right sides of conveyer belt 2 corresponding to laser cutting mechanism lower section Outside respectively sets one and extrudes press mechanism, and the rear end of conveyer belt 2 sets cross roll road 6, and the rear end in cross roll road 6 sets hopper 7, and cross roll road 6 leans on One end of nearly conveyer belt 2 is higher than close to one end of hopper 7.
Laser cutting mechanism includes generating device of laser 22, laser delivery pipe 23 and laser cutting head 24, and wherein laser is sent out Generating apparatus 22 is arranged on the bottom surface of installing plate 21, the bottom of generating device of laser 22 connection laser delivery pipe 23, laser delivery pipe 23 Bottom connects laser cutting head 24, and the side of laser delivery pipe 23 sets auxiliary gas inlet 25, and generating device of laser produces laser, Laser is sent to laser cutting head by laser delivery pipe, coordinates the movement of transverse slide to cut composite plate.
As shown in Fig. 2 side pressing mechanism includes side cylinder 13, side cylinder 13 connects side guide 14, and the is set on side guide 14 One rubber blanket 15, in cutting process, the side cylinder moving of both sides, band dynamic pressure plate carries out compression positioning to composite plate side, improves Cutting accuracy, the first rubber blanket can not only prevent from scratching composite surface, can also be anti-skidding.
Extruding press mechanism includes top gas cylinder 16, and top gas cylinder 16 connects top pressing board 17, the second rubber blanket 18 is set on top pressing board 17, Extruding for front and rear sides sets wood properly test device 26 and thickness detection apparatus 27 respectively on the second rubber blanket 18 of press mechanism, cutting During, the top cylinder moving of both sides, band dynamic pressure plate carries out compression positioning to compound plate top surface, improves cutting accuracy, and second Rubber blanket can not only prevent scuffing composite surface, can also be anti-skidding, and wood properly test device and thickness detection apparatus are arranged on second On rubber blanket, composite plate material and thickness can be detected, laser cutting mechanism is suitably adjusted, without installed in it Its position saves space, can be detected when extruding press mechanism and composite plate being compressed, also simplify technique.
Cross roll road 6 sets infrared sensor 12 above one end of hopper 7, and composite plate that can be after dicing is slided from cross roll road Composite plate is counted during material bin, worker's working strength is reduced, improves operating efficiency.
Main support 1 sets touch screen 10 and scram button 11 on side, intuitively device can be controlled everywhere, scram button Can when emergency situations occur emergency shutdown.
According to above structure, during work, it would be desirable to which the composite plate of cutting is placed on conveyer belt, and two side shields can prevent multiple Plywood drops and carries out spacing, is transported to when needing cutting position, conveyer belt is out of service, and both sides side pressing mechanism is first to compound Plate carries out compression positioning, then extrudes press mechanism and carries out compression positioning to composite plate, while extrudes press mechanism and pass through wood properly test Device and thickness detection apparatus detect to composite plate material and thickness, laser cutting mechanism is suitably adjusted, hydraulic pressure The required height of retractor device adjustment laser cutting mechanism, is then cut by laser mechanism and is slid laterally by transverse slide, Cut, cutting completes rear side pressing mechanism, extrudes press mechanism and is cut by laser mechanism and all sets back, and conveyer belt continues to transport OK, composite plate is transported to cross roll road from conveyer belt, is then delivered in hopper, while composite plate can be entered by infrared sensor Row counts.
